Win UEFA EURO 2008 ™ — Compete as one of 52 teams from qualification right through to a virtual reproduction of UEFA EURO 2008™ in Austria and Switzerland.

 

Captain Your Country – Play as yourself on the same team with up to three friends, all playing individual positions on the pitch. Compete collaboratively to win games but compete against each other for the captaincy. Develop your player through eight status levels to earn the captaincy of your country and the right to lead your team.

 

Create Yourself – Play alongside your heroes by customizing yourself in game. Place your name on your jersey, then earn experience points to enhance your skills and reputation.

 

Battle of the Nations — Represent your country online against your rivals around the world to win global supremacy. Earn individual and team points. Think your nation is the best? Now you can prove it!

 

EURO Online Knockout Draw— Battle gamers from other nations online in 16-team single elimination tournaments to gain points for your nation.

 

Enhanced Penalty Kicks -- Experience the challenge of a penalty shoot-out as if you were on the pitch. Master your nerves to score the goal that puts your team in the UEFA EURO 2008™ final.

 

Interactive Celebrations — Score a goal and then control your player’s movements and actions to celebrate the way you want to.

 

Dynamic Rain and Mud — Winter weather from across Europe is authentically re-created to simulate real-world playing conditions. Experience driving rain that creates sloppy, muddy pitches which dramatically impacts passing and player performance.

 

Home & Away Match Strategy– CPU mimics international soccer by creating strategic, defensive formations for away teams intent on playing for a draw.

 

Authentic Stadiums — Compete in all 8 official stadiums of UEFA EURO 2008™.

 

Team Managers — Watch reactions from team managers on the sideline as they shout encouragement or become disappointed in your team’s performance.

 

EA SPORTS Soccer Engine – An evolution of the market leading EA SPORTS soccer engine with enhanced goalkeeper AI, collisions, and trapping that make this the best-playing EA SPORTS soccer game.

 

Story of Qualifying — Play the qualifying campaign and step up at key defining moments to lead your country to Europe’s biggest prize. Complete team and individual tasks.

 

Dynamic Player Ratings— Real-time player ratings change based on actual player performance, simulating the momentum swings of a real season.

Developer EA Canada has announced that they are to release yet another EURO footy game onto the multiplatform scene. They've announced that the title will be scheduled for release come April 11th, 2008.

 

The game is scheduled to appear on the PlayStation 3 console as well as more than 5 others. With EA's recent announcement that they still haven't quite hurdled over the PS3 development hitch, you can probably expect this game to still play just fine, much like FIFA 08.

 

“Our game, UEFA Euro 2008, celebrates the passion fans have for their national teams by capturing all of the national rivalries in-game, and enabling you to captain your country or play as your heroes and inspire them to glory,” said EA’s Lead Producer Simon Humber.

 

“We have taken our football engine to another level and added innovative new features to create a video game that captures and simulates the real-world experience and all the emotion of this tournament.”
